What is German Spy Museum?

  • A privately operated museum in Berlin-Mitte dedicated to the global history of espionage, from early codebreaking to modern cyber intelligence
  • A curated collection showcasing authentic spy gadgets and encrypted communication devices, including Enigma machines, covert microphones and Cold War-era surveillance equipment
  • An exhibition design combining historical documents, multimedia presentations and cinema props—such as original James Bond artefacts—within a contemporary gallery space

Couple-Friendly Activities in German Spy Museum

Laser Maze:

Race through a web of laser beams.

Tip: Compete for best time and check your ranking on the leaderboard.

Code-breaking Stations:

Send and decode messages with Enigma and Morse machines.

Tip: Take turns encoding and decoding to cover more ground.

Bug-detection Challenge:

Hunt hidden listening devices in a replica office.

Tip: Swap roles frequently to spot every concealed bug.

Historic Artifacts:

See rare items like Stasi coat-cameras and Bond film props.

Tip: Use the multimedia stations for background on each piece.

Lie-Detector Test:

Try to fool the polygraph by controlling your voice and pulse.

Tip: Speak naturally and stay calm to beat the detector.

How to Make the Most of Your Visit to German Spy Museum

  1. Buy Tickets Online: Reserve a weekday morning slot to avoid lines.
  2. Join Free Guided Tours: Check the lobby desk for hourly English tours.
  3. Pack Light: Use free lockers to store bags and move quickly through exhibits.
